Hello again from Dresden! The Department of Finance has been very busy with the release of the 2010 tax forms. For the 2010 calendar year, Weakley County employed 1,243 people and paid out over $24 million in payroll.  

As of publication time, the Trustee’s Office has collected 87.26 percent   or $7,920,291 of the 2010 property taxes. These dollars are one of the main sources of revenue for county operations.  

With eight months into the 2010-2011 fiscal year we are quickly approaching budget season. Our elected and appointed county officials will begin preparing their budgets for the next fiscal year.

In the next couple of months, our county commissioners will be reviewing these proposed budgets.  To keep informed of the budget process, you can check the county website, www.weakleycountytn.gov, to see the committee meeting schedules along with the minutes from each meeting.

One reader sent a question regarding the status of the county’s debt and how we compare or rank with other counties. As of the last State of Tennessee Comptroller’s audit release, June 30, 2010, Weakley County owes approximately $20,500,223 in debt. 

In comparison with the bordering counties, Weakley County’s debt is $4.7 to $7.2 million dollars less.
